2. Added a lot of network tools
The NETMAN Upgrade add same network
utilities into OpenTTY, see a list of this
tools above:
- gaddr ip adress with a hostname
- fw get informations of a ip adress
- wget download files from network
- server start a localhost server
- ifconfig show ip adresses for a host and it interfaces
- netstat show network status [Online/ Offline]
- curl do a HTTP request with a website
- genip generate random ip adresses
- hostname show hostname for a ip adress or local machine
- connect connect with a server
